@charset "utf-8";* {margin:0;padding:0;border:0;outline:0;background-size:100% auto;box-sizing:border-box;font-family:"PingFang SC";background-repeat:no-repeat;background-position:center center;font-size:0.18666666666666668rem;}
ul,li {list-style:none;}
a {text-decoration:none;color:#333333;cursor:pointer;}
img {border:none;display:block;width:100%}
em,i {font-style:normal;}
.w690 {width:9.2rem;margin:0 auto;}
.clearfix:after {display:block;content:" ";height:0;visibility:hidden;clear:both;}
.clearfix {*zoom:1;}
.content {width:10rem;margin:0 auto;}
.title_1 {text-align:center;padding:1.2rem 0 0.6666666666666666rem;}
.title_1 span {font-size:0.6666666666666666rem;display:block;color:#000000;font-weight:500;}
.title_1 p {font-size:0.32rem;color:#737373;padding-top:0.3333333333333333rem;font-weight:400;}
.banner {height:5.333333333333333rem;background:url(images/banner.jpg)center top no-repeat;background-size:100%;margin-top:1.333333rem}
.banner span {display:block;font-weight:500;font-size:0.29333333333333333rem;color:#000000;padding-top:0.7333333333333333rem;}
.banner span em {display:inline-block;width:0.013333333333333334rem;height:0.25333333333333335rem;background:#5A5A5A;margin-right:0.16rem;vertical-align:-0.02666666666666667rem;}
.banner span::before {display:inline-block;content:"";width:1.3733333333333333rem;height:0.44rem;background:url(images/b_logo.png);background-size:100%;margin-right:0.16rem;vertical-align:-0.08rem;}
.banner p {font-weight:500;font-size:0.6666666666666666rem;color:#000000;margin-top:0.13333333333333333rem;margin-bottom:0.2rem;}
.banner>div {font-size:0.32rem;}
.banner i {display:inline-block;font-weight:500;font-size:0.32rem;color:#000000;margin-right:0.21333333333333335rem;}
.banner i em {display:inline-block;width:0.4rem;height:0.4rem;background:url(images/b_ico1.png);background-size:100%;margin-right:0.02666666666666667rem;vertical-align:-0.06666666666666667rem;}
.banner i:nth-child(2) em {background:url(images/b_ico2.png);background-size:100%;}
.banner i:nth-child(3) em {background:url(images/b_ico3.png);background-size:100%;}
.banner i:nth-child(4) em {background:url(images/b_ico4.png);background-size:100%;}
.banner a {display:block;text-align:center;width:3.3733333333333335rem;height:1.0666666666666667rem;background:#FFFFFF;border-radius:0.5333333333333333rem;font-weight:bold;font-size:0.4rem;color:#2B4EFF;line-height:1.0666666666666667rem;margin-top:0.8rem;}
.second_menu {height:1.2rem;position:relative;}
.second_menu .swiper-container {width:8rem!important;margin-left:0;position:static!important;}
.second_menu .swiper-slide {width:2rem!important;}
.second_menu .swiper-slide a {font-size:0.373333rem;color:#121212;display:block;text-align:center;line-height:1.2rem;}
.second_menu .swiper-slide a.on {color:#ff8000;}
.second_menu .swiper-slide a:hover {color:#ff8000;}
.second_menu .swiper-button-prev,.second_menu .swiper-container-rtl .swiper-button-next {left:8.2rem;background-color:#ff9000;color:#fff;width:0.5rem;border-radius:0.1rem;height:0.5rem;--swiper-navigation-size:0.533333rem!important;}
.second_menu .swiper-button-next,.second_menu .swiper-container-rtl .swiper-button-prev {right:-0.266666rem;background-color:#ff9000;color:#fff;width:0.5rem;border-radius:0.1rem;height:0.5rem;--swiper-navigation-size:0.533333rem!important;}
.btn_dh {text-align:center;display:block;width:5.413333333333333rem;height:1.0666666666666667rem;background:#0050D5;border-radius:0.05333333333333334rem;font-weight:500;font-size:0.4266666666666667rem;color:#FFFFFF;line-height:1.0666666666666667rem;margin:0.8rem auto 0;}
.floor_1 {overflow:hidden;height:auto;padding-bottom:1.2rem;}
.floor_1 ul {width:9.2rem;height:11.133333333333333rem;background:#FFFFFF;box-shadow:0rem 0.04rem 0.3466666666666667rem 0.05333333333333334rem rgba(233,240,250,0.8);border-radius:0.13333333333333333rem;display:flex;justify-content:space-between;flex-wrap:wrap;}
.floor_1 ul li {width:50%;height:5.333333333333333rem;border:1px solid rgba(0,0,0,0);box-sizing:border-box;}
.floor_1 ul li img {display:block;margin:0.5333333333333333rem auto 0.26666666666666666rem;width:2.36rem;height:2.36rem;}
.floor_1 ul li p {font-weight:bold;font-size:0.32rem;color:#575757;line-height:0.48rem;margin-left:0.37333333333333335rem;}
.floor_1 ul li p em {font-weight:bold;font-size:0.32rem;color:#123AE8;line-height:0.48rem;}
.floor_2 {height:auto;overflow:hidden;background:url(images/fl2_bg.jpg)center top no-repeat;background-size:100%;padding-bottom:1.2rem;}
.floor_2 .w690 {width:9.2rem;height:7.76rem;background:#FFFFFF;box-shadow:0rem 0.12rem 0.3466666666666667rem 0.05333333333333334rem rgba(240,244,251,0.8);border-radius:0.13333333333333333rem;display:flex;justify-content:center;align-items:center;}
.floor_2 img {width:8.16rem;height:6.426666666666667rem;margin:0 auto;}
.floor_3 {overflow:hidden;height:auto;padding-bottom:1.2rem;background:#F9F9F9;}
.floor_3 ul {display:flex;justify-content:space-between;flex-wrap:wrap;}
.floor_3 ul li {width:4.333333333333333rem;height:5.8533333333333335rem;background:#FFFFFF;box-shadow:0rem 0.02666666666666667rem 0.08rem 0.02666666666666667rem rgba(233,233,233,0.8);border-radius:0.13333333333333333rem;margin-bottom:0.5333333333333333rem;}
.floor_3 ul li:nth-child(n+3) {height:6.426666666666667rem;}
.floor_3 ul li img {display:block;width:4.333333333333333rem;height:1.8rem;}
.floor_3 ul li span {display:block;text-align:center;font-weight:bold;font-size:0.4rem;color:#000000;margin:0.6rem auto 0.26666666666666666rem;}
.floor_3 ul li p {font-weight:400;font-size:0.3466666666666667rem;color:#666668;line-height:0.56rem;padding-left:0.44rem;}
.floor_3 a {margin-top:0.26666666666666666rem;}
.floor_4 {overflow:hidden;height:auto;padding-bottom:1.2rem;}
.floor_4 ul {display:flex;justify-content:space-between;flex-wrap:wrap;}
.floor_4 ul li {width:9.213333333333333rem;height:6.746666666666667rem;background:#F9F9FF;border-radius:0.13333333333333333rem;border:3px solid #6C44ED;box-sizing:border-box;padding:0.4666666666666667rem 0 0 0.6533333333333333rem;}
.floor_4 ul li:nth-child(2) {height:8.2rem;background:#F8FAFF;border:3px solid #2956FF;margin-top:0.4rem;}
.floor_4 ul li span {display:block;font-weight:bold;font-size:0.37333333333333335rem;color:#000000;margin-bottom:0.14666666666666667rem;}
.floor_4 ul li span::before {display:inline-block;content:"";width:0.64rem;height:0.64rem;background:url(images/fl4_ico1.png);background-size:100%;margin-right:0.25333333333333335rem;vertical-align:-0.16rem;}
.floor_4 ul li:nth-child(1) span:nth-child(3)::before {background:url(images/fl4_ico2.png);background-size:100%;}
.floor_4 ul li:nth-child(1) span:nth-child(5)::before {background:url(images/fl4_ico3.png);background-size:100%;}
.floor_4 ul li:nth-child(2) span:nth-child(1)::before {background:url(images/fl4_ico4.png);background-size:100%;}
.floor_4 ul li:nth-child(2) span:nth-child(3)::before {background:url(images/fl4_ico5.png);background-size:100%;}
.floor_4 ul li:nth-child(2) span:nth-child(5)::before {background:url(images/fl4_ico6.png);background-size:100%;}
.floor_4 ul li p {font-weight:400;font-size:0.32rem;color:#000000;line-height:0.48rem;margin-left:0.8933333333333333rem;margin-bottom:0.26666666666666666rem;}
.floor_5 {overflow:hidden;height:auto;padding-bottom:1.2rem;background:#F9F9F9;}
.floor_5 ul {display:flex;justify-content:space-between;flex-wrap:wrap;}
.floor_5 ul li {width:23%;height:2.1333333333333333rem;font-weight:bold;font-size:0.32rem;color:#000000;text-align:center;}
.floor_5 ul li::before {display:block;margin:0 auto 0.13333333333333333rem;content:"";width:0.8666666666666667rem;height:0.8666666666666667rem;background:url(images/fl5_ico1.png);background-size:100%;}
.floor_5 ul li:nth-child(2)::before {background:url(images/fl5_ico2.png);background-size:100%;}
.floor_5 ul li:nth-child(3)::before {background:url(images/fl5_ico3.png);background-size:100%;}
.floor_5 ul li:nth-child(4)::before {background:url(images/fl5_ico4.png);background-size:100%;}
.floor_5 ul li:nth-child(5)::before {background:url(images/fl5_ico5.png);background-size:100%;}
.floor_5 ul li:nth-child(6)::before {background:url(images/fl5_ico6.png);background-size:100%;}
.floor_5 ul li:nth-child(7)::before {background:url(images/fl5_ico7.png);background-size:100%;}
.floor_5 ul li:nth-child(8)::before {background:url(images/fl5_ico8.png);background-size:100%;}
.floor_5 a {margin-top:0.13333333333333333rem;}
.floor_6 {height:auto;overflow:hidden;padding-bottom:1.2rem;}
.floor_6 .info {width:9.146666666666667rem;margin:0 auto;height:auto;overflow:hidden;}
.floor_6 .info p {width:2.1333333333333333rem;text-align:center;border-right:0.013333333333333334rem solid #E1E1E1;float:left;height:1rem;font-size:0.48rem;color:#1D59F1;font-weight:bold;}
.floor_6 .info p:nth-child(2) {width:2rem;}
.floor_6 .info p:nth-child(3) {width:2.2666666666666666rem;}
.floor_6 .info p:nth-child(4) {width:2.7466666666666666rem;}
.floor_6 .info p:last-of-type {border:none;}
.floor_6 .info span {display:block;font-weight:400;font-size:0.24rem;color:#000000;margin-top:0.06666666666666667rem;}
.floor_6 ul {display:flex;justify-content:space-between;flex-wrap:wrap;margin-top:0.6666666666666666rem;width:9.2rem;height:7.706666666666667rem;background:#FFFFFF;box-shadow:0rem 0.06666666666666667rem 0.24rem 0.02666666666666667rem rgba(226,230,244,0.8);border-radius:0.13333333333333333rem;}
.floor_6 ul li {width:3.066666666666667rem;height:7.706666666666667rem;background:#F5F8FF;border:1px solid rgba(0,0,0,0);box-sizing:border-box;padding:0.4rem 0 0 0;}
.floor_6 ul li h5 {display:block;font-weight:bold;font-size:0.4rem;color:#010101;margin-bottom:0.5333333333333333rem;text-align:center;}
.floor_6 ul li h5::before {display:block;margin:0 auto 0.29333333333333333rem;content:"";width:0.8666666666666667rem;height:0.8666666666666667rem;background:url(images/fl6_ico1.png);background-size:100%;}
.floor_6 ul li:nth-child(2) h5::before {background:url(images/fl6_ico2.png);background-size:100%;}
.floor_6 ul li:nth-child(3) h5::before {background:url(images/fl6_ico3.png);background-size:100%;}
.floor_6 ul li span {display:block;font-weight:bold;font-size:0.32rem;color:#1D59F1;margin-bottom:0.2rem;padding-left:0.36rem;}
.floor_6 ul li p {font-weight:500;font-size:0.24rem;color:#6E6E6E;line-height:0.37333333333333335rem;margin-bottom:0.26666666666666666rem;padding-left:0.36rem;}
